(420) Will of J. A. Pitts, Deceased
State of Tennessee, Rutherford County
I, J A Pitts, of Rutherford County, Tennessee, being of sound mindand disposing memory d o hereby make and declare this to be my last willand testament, hereby revoking and making al l other will s by me made.
First. I desire that all my just debts and funeral expenses be paid.
Second. It is my will and desire that my wife, Mary Brandon Pitts, haveall of my property , real, personal and mixed, of every kind, of which Imay die seized and possessed, as long a s she may live, then at her deathI wish the property to be disposed of as follows:
I desire that Mrs. Ben S. Arnett, or her heirs, if she be dead atthe death of my said wi fe, Mary Brandon Pitts, be paid the sum of$350.00, before there is any division of my estate.
All the balance of my estate, after the payment of my debts, and thepayment of the abov e mentioned bequest to Mrs. Ben S. Arnett, I will tomy son Virgil Pitts.
I appoint Ben S Arnett as Executor of this my will, and request thatthe Court will not r equire him to give any bond as such Executor.
In witness whereof I have this day set my had.
This July 11, 1936.
J. A. Pitts
The is obviously some confusion about the wives of John Pitts. One reportindicates:
1st wife: Lou Burnett
2nd wife: Sarah Frances Arnett
3rd wife: Mary Elizabeth Brandon (as above)

From Paul Hildebrandt:
Daniel Nowlan was the son of John Nowlan. Depending on source reviewed, he was born between 1574 and 1595 in Tullow, County Carlow, Ireland. He died c.1650 in Tullow. He married Anastase O'Brien, daughter of Torlagh O'Brien. Two children have been identified.
Most sources place her birth in Co. Carlow, but her father was established in Co. Tipperary, and later moved to Co. Carlow, so Tipperary stands as a possible place of birth. It has been suggested that Daniel was married twice, and that Anastase was the second wife. If so, that would explain the gap between the births of Patrick and Edmund. If so, who was the first wife? No record has been found for the additional marriage.
